    prayer Shawl patterns

    here is one I found online:
    The Original Prayer Shawl Crochet Pattern © 2011 All rights reserved.



    Developed by Rita Glod


    Chain 54 stitches or desired width of shawl.
    Chain 1, turn, single crochet in each of the stitches to end. Chain 3 and turn.
    Double crochet in top of each single crochet. Repeat this row 2 more times.
    Chain 1 and do 1 row of single crochet to end. Chain 3 and turn.
    Do 3 rows of double crochet. Repeat pattern to end (1 row single, 3 rows double)
    End with 1 row of single. Finish with fringe.


    *Note: that crocheting typically uses more yarn than knitting, so you might have to adjust the width and size of hook or use another 1/2 skein.

    It has been suggested that skeins of the same dye lot be purchased.

    Rita,

    I have used Simply Soft ('I' hook) and I Love This Yarn ('J' hook) and just did double crochet for 22x72 rectangles. The one I'm working on now is Simply Soft, 'I' hook, and doing a 3 dc, ch1 sk 1 across ending with a 3dc. The alternate row is just a dc. It's OK and at least isn't as boring as just the dc! It's about 3 skeins of Simply Soft and 2 of the I Love This Yarn.
